The world’s elite runners, jumpers, and gymnasts will compete for personal and national glory at the Olympic Games in Paris.

ADVERTISEMENT

Around 10,500 athletes from 206 countries will compete in 329 events at the Olympic Games, with the top performers earning their place on the podiums.

Winning a medal at this prestigious stage is a matter of honor for every athlete, and securing a gold medal can elevate a sportsperson to a national hero.

 

Here’s a look at the countries that have won the most gold medals in Summer Olympics history.

United States 1,070

Soviet Union 395

Great Britain 292

People’s Republic of China 263

Germany 239

France 231

Italy 222

Hungary 182

Japan 169

Australia 162
